From 7/24 Alger creek was flowing good across the trail near Alger Camp. I heard falls creek clearly from above on Falls Trail. Saw at least half a dozen bear scats along Falls Trail between Alger Creek and the Dobbs Trail Spur. Didn’t see the camps but expect they’re a little untidy having been closed for most of the last year.
SGWA Trail crew worked on the Falls creek/momyer trail 7/24. Trees removed. Lots of water at all campsites.
Water availability report comes out on Tuesdays with permits for upcoming weekend. Also is updated as it changes on the Trails drop down on this site, the first tab.
